The Importance of Effective Customer Relationship Management
Customer Relationship Management (CRM) involves strategies and technologies used to manage and analyze customer interactions and data throughout the customer lifecycle. Effective CRM helps businesses improve customer satisfaction, increase loyalty, and drive revenue growth. IT solutions play a key role in optimizing CRM processes by providing the tools needed to track, analyze, and engage with customers more effectively.
Key IT Strategies for Superior CRM
1. Implement a Comprehensive CRM System
Importance
A robust CRM system centralizes customer data, providing a single source of truth for all interactions and transactions. This integration helps businesses better understand their customers, personalize interactions, and streamline processes.
IT Strategies
Centralized Database Use a CRM system to consolidate customer information, including contact details, purchase history, and interaction records. This ensures that all customer-facing teams have access to up-to-date and accurate data.
Automation Features Leverage CRM automation to streamline routine tasks such as follow-ups, lead assignments, and data entry. Automation improves efficiency and reduces the risk of human error.
Example
An ecommerce company adopts a CRM system that integrates with its sales and marketing platforms. This integration allows for seamless tracking of customer interactions, automated follow-up emails, and personalized product recommendations based on purchase history.
2. Utilize Data Analytics for Insights
Importance
Data analytics provides valuable insights into customer behavior, preferences, and trends. By analyzing this data, businesses can make informed decisions and tailor their strategies to better meet customer needs.
IT Strategies
Customer Segmentation Use data analytics to segment customers based on demographics, behavior, and purchasing patterns. This enables targeted marketing and personalized offers.
Predictive Analytics Implement predictive analytics to forecast customer needs and trends. This helps in anticipating customer demands and preparing strategies accordingly.
Example
A financial services firm uses data analytics to segment its customer base and identify high-value clients. Predictive models help the firm anticipate customer needs and offer tailored financial products, leading to increased customer satisfaction and higher conversion rates.
3. Enhance Communication Channels
Importance
Effective communication channels are essential for building strong customer relationships. IT solutions can enhance communication by providing multiple touchpoints and ensuring timely responses.
IT Strategies
Omnichannel Support Implement an omnichannel CRM solution that integrates various communication channels such as email, chat, social media, and phone. This ensures a seamless customer experience across different platforms.
Chatbots and AI Use chatbots and AI-driven tools to provide instant support and answer common customer queries. This improves response times and frees up human agents for more complex issues.
Example
A tech support company deploys an omnichannel CRM system that integrates live chat, email, and social media support. Chatbots handle routine inquiries, while human agents manage more complex issues, resulting in faster resolution times and improved customer satisfaction.
4. Foster Personalization and Engagement
Importance
Personalized interactions enhance customer satisfaction and loyalty. IT solutions enable businesses to tailor their interactions based on customer data, leading to more meaningful engagements.
IT Strategies
Personalized Marketing Use CRM data to create personalized marketing campaigns and offers based on individual customer preferences and behavior.
Customer Feedback Implement feedback tools to gather and analyze customer opinions. Use this feedback to improve products, services, and customer interactions.
Example
A travel agency leverages CRM data to create personalized travel recommendations for its customers based on their past bookings and preferences. Personalized emails with tailored travel packages lead to higher engagement and repeat bookings.
